Despite a world awash with liquidity, large infrastructure supply gaps exist across developing and emerging markets, and global investor appetite for prudent risk-taking remains limited in key sectors and in regions such as Africa, Asia, and Latin America. The roundtable will convene industry and government leaders, multilateral development bank (MDB) officials, and other experts involved in private sector development financing to explore alternative investment ideas and partnership opportunities that could further spur private sector appetite for infrastructure investment in emerging markets and developing economies.
